Wonder (Paperback)

Customer Review

Wonder is a book that has so much of talk in the blogosphere that I could not help myself to buy it at the first opportunity that I had. The cover was both simple but enigmatic, and the sight of all, I was moved. I was sure and certain that this reading would please me.

This novel could have told the story of a little banal boy who goes to college for the first time, which made new friends (and simultaneously, enemies), with a loving and caring family around him ... Yes but now, August (more familiarly called Auggie), is not a little boy like the others. Auggie was born with facial deformities very important that distorts his entire face. How this little boy of only 10 years he could face the ridicule of his young age and the gaze of passers supported on the street?

I was stunned and shocked to discover both the morphology of Auggie. His deformity is clearly described, but impossible for me to represent me in real life, on the face of a human being. As he himself says in the book "What you imagine is probably worse" ... It must be said, that little phrase causes chills. Even if the performance was not completely realistic in my mind, the pain and sorrow felt by strong Auggit about the eyes of others touched me.
I understood his terror, that he has contempt for passersby, who watch as if they had mercy on him. Be ogled all day long as a monster, a freak, not to be easygoing. Moreover, Auggie is young, very young, and it's almost all alone in feeling this horrible suffering. Some passages of the novel still messed me than others, especially when her younger sister, Via, trying to keep him away from his new life of high school ... it is clear at this point that it is ashamed of his brother ... but yet, what she loves!

Sidelined by all, rejected his difference, it will try to ignore and fight for what he really is. A battle he will face every day, and he is sure to never be fully recovered. The difference is a chance, and Auggie has proven to us.

With infinite delicacy, RJ Palacio reveals gentle adventures and events of the sad life of Auggie.
One of the major positive points, which I enjoyed, was in different parts of the novel, which are cut according to the figures. Each party, we discover a new character in the story, and we also can follow him, discover his opinion on the main plot, so the story of Auggie. A very good idea, which charmed me.

But there's not just that which charmed me. This novel has managed to move me. I sympathize with the pain of Auggie, fears of parents, friends of support, at the mercy of people ... Even if the world will not change anytime soon, this book is a renewed optimism, and Meanwhile, a weight accuser against all.
The author shows us how our selfishness and curiosity can cause harm to others. Solidarity is one of the best qualities that can exist on Earth. Unfortunately, she is scarce over the years ...

In conclusion, I would say that I would not be surprised to find one day that book into a film. It is so moving, original and unusual, that every time he would cry all the people who go to see it.
